We are seeking a Project Accountant to provide strategic financial input and advice to the Project Management Team and Senior Management. This role involves a strong focus on the financial aspects of ongoing projects related to the implementation of the National Resources and Waste Strategy.
Key Duties:
- Prepare budgets, forecasts, and variance reports for ongoing projects, providing financial advice and analysis to aid decision-making.
- Assist in the preparation of financial information for stakeholders, including the Board and Shareholder.
- Advise senior management on the financial standing of projects and identify areas of concern.
- Provide guidance on financial issues such as correct coding of invoices and credit control procedures.
- Tailor reports to Service Managers on budgetary performance and advise on corrective actions.
- Develop financial models for new business opportunities in conjunction with the Project Management Team.
- Assist in delivering performance targets and provide accurate reports for the company's senior management team and Board.
- Assist the Head of Projects and Business Development with project budgets and reporting.
Required Skills & Qualifications:
- Degree or equivalent level qualification, or equivalent demonstrable experience.
- Qualified AAT Accountant or progressing towards an appropriate accountancy qualification (e.g., CIMA, CIPFA).
- Substantial knowledge of financial reporting and budget preparation.
- Experience in producing financial reports for a range of stakeholders.
- Experience in a finance team within a commercially driven organisation.
- Experience in developing budgets with service and project managers.
